It's still a stretch for an NA V6 with a lot of bolt ons to run with a C5 Vette. Ltngdrvr posted that video of me running my uncles Vette at the track. Granted it's a Z06 model but keep in mind the Z06 only has 60 hp on the stock Touring models. My car is putting down about 420 hp at the wheels. A stock Z06 puts down 340-350 to the wheels and a stock Touring model puts down about 290-300 hp to the wheels. Difference is the Vette is 500 lbs lighter. So put 2 fat ass biatches in the front passenger seat of a C5 Touring Vette and it still would be a stretch for a bolt on V6 Mustang to run with just the driver to hang with the Vette let alone walk away from it.

Think about the phrase "walk away" and be honest with yourself. Well let me be honest with myself. My V6 with a Procharger would just barely qualify as being able to "walk away" from a C5 Vette. I own Mustang and I'm just being honest, I know I can beat a stock C5 Vette however I don't know that I'd beat it so bad that everyone would say I could walk away from one.

The C5 Vette is a car that I believe drew a line in the sand. It's when American car manufacturers said "screw this crap, we're targeting buyers in the market to buy a Ferarri or Lamborghini"

I love my Mustang, but insurance, gas mileage and "seats 4" aside I'd take a C5 or C6 any day of week over my Mustang when it comes to all out performance.
